Why Digital Twins Matter in Blending Operations

  • Food, chemical, and pharmaceutical manufacturers alike deal with a complex mix of factors in blending operations. Particulate behaviors, equipment design, and varying scale-up conditions all present unique challenges. Traditional trial-and-error methods often require numerous test batches, driving up time and costs. Digital Twin Technology offers a proactive, data-driven approach that helps avoid these pitfalls.
  • A digital twin is essentially a virtual mirror of your real-world blending process. By integrating data from sensors and advanced simulations, these models let you predict and analyze the performance of your blending operations in real-time. The result is less reliance on guesswork and more confidence in your processes, from early product development all the way to full-scale production

DEM and the Importance of Powder Calibration

  • Discrete Element Method (DEM) is the cornerstone of our Digital Twin solutions for blending. DEM simulates particle behavior, capturing essential details like shape, size distribution, cohesion, and frictional properties. These factors dictate whether ingredients blend seamlessly or segregate during mixing.
  • Yet high-fidelity simulations require reliable input data. That’s why calibration of powders is so crucial. Our team at Intelimek conducts systematic lab tests and experiments to calibrate inputs to the DEM models. This ensures the digital model corresponds closely to how your specific materials behave in a real blending environment.

Overcoming Common Blending Challenges

  • Blend Consistency: Achieving uniform particle distribution is vital for both quality and regulatory compliance—particularly relevant in industries like food and pharmaceuticals.
  • Scale-Up Efficiency: Moving from a pilot plant to full-scale production can be fraught with unexpected setbacks. Digital twins reduce risks by virtually simulating the effects of larger-scale operations.
  • Maintenance Predictability: Breakdowns in blending equipment can disrupt production timelines. With real-time analytics and predictive maintenance models, you can catch issues before they become critical.
  • Enhanced Teamwork:By offering a clear, visual representation of blending processes, digital twins enable engineers, operators, and management to collaborate more effectively.
